Lasting Fruit from ministry only comes when people receive grace from God. God is the source. Prayer is the Conductor.
The conductor that links man to God is prayer. Any type of ministry effort will fail if it doesn't bring people to the throne of God's grace. Prayer must never be pushed out, people need the Lord! Lk 18:1; Heb 4:16; Mk 11:15, 16-17; John 2:15, 16
Prayer is essential for effective ministry and lasting fruit
Effective ministry begins with prayer, is sustained by prayer and concludes with people seeking God in prayer. Jesus promised where two or more gather in his name he would be in their midst. Prayer Stand Evangelism is powerful because it is designed to bring people to the throne of God's grace where they can find grace to help in every time of trouble. Mt 18:19-20

Go where the Fish are - Great places to set up
Jesus command was very simple: "Go into all the world and proclaim the gospel to the whole creation." "Teach them to observe all that I have commanded you." "Make disciples of all nations." Jesus disciples followed his directions: "They went out and preached everywhere, while the Lord worked with them."
For you to be effective you need to follow Christ's same directions. Set up your Prayer Stand wherever there are people and the doors are open. If the door closes in one location, move to another. Not everyone will respond. Pray for "Divine appointments." As you pray, the Lord will send people to you and open their heart to the gospel. These are the people to minister the word to and pray with.

Public Response. God resists the proud and gives grace to the humble
The greater the level of pride in the area you set up in, the lower the response will be to your outreach. Set up among the rich and powerful and you will have a low response. Set up a Prayer Stand around those whose circumstances are difficult and you will have a great response. James 4:6; 1 Cor 1:26, 27-28 |

He that winneth souls is wise. Don't give Satan Ammunition
Be thoughtful with people and their questions. The apostle Paul "reasoned, taught, tried to persuade, testified, encouraged and strenghened." Acts 17:2, 17; 18:4-5, 11, 19, 23. He did not expect quick immediate responses from everyone. As long as people would hear him he gave them time. When they openly rejected the gospel then he moved on. He reasoned daily from one place in Ephesus for two years so that everyone in the area heard the word. Acts 19:8, 9, 10. The result of this consistent public witness was the word of the Lord continued to increase and prevail mightily. Acts 19:20. His witnessing was filled with love and concern for his hearers. Acts 20:31. He shared the whole counsel of God: the heavy convicting truth about the law, sin, rightousness, self-control, judgment to come and the good news of Christ crucified and resurrected. His one goal was that his hearers would experience repentance toward God and faith in the Lord Jesus Christ. Acts 20:20, 21, 26-27, 31. His own actions demonstrated a transformed holy life empowered by the Holy Spirit and full of God's love. His hands were the hands of a servant, ever ready to work so he could minister to the needs of those about him. Acts 20:34.

What to Say before they leave
Some of the people you pray with will need you to keep praying for them and welcome ongoing contact. Simply ask them: "Would you like us to continue to remember your need in prayer?" They will say "yes." Then reply: "We need your information so that we can be praying and contact you to see if God has answered." They will then give you their contact information.
You or someone on your team should fill out a Prayer Request Contact Sheet or Card for them. This insures you can read it. Simply go right down the sheet saying: "How do you spell you name? What's your address? Phone number?" and fill in the contact info as they give it to you. Make sure you write down their prayer request and other helpful notes. Get others involved praying for the most important needs. Call them up after you have been praying and find out if God has answered prayer. They will be grateful that you have been praying for them and may want more information about you and your ministry. Be there for them and God will open great doors of ministry to you. Open Door to your community. Bring people through the door into relationship with a body of believer who are commited to obeying Christ's commands.
When someone responds positively to the gospel at the Prayer Stand you are just getting started. Your public witness is only half Jesus Great Commission. Now invite them to meet with you weekly to learn more about Jesus and his commands. You need to help them become commited followers of Christ. Mt 28:19-20; Mk 16:15-16, 20; Lk 19:10 |
